What the story claims
3 claims · each scored for market impact
The Walton Family Holdings Trust sold approximately 4.42 million shares of Walmart (WMT) on June 16, 2026, for about $535.8 million. — Large-scale insider selling by controlling interests often signals a peak in valuation or creates significant downward price pressure due to increased supply.
-0.40The Walton Family Holdings Trust has sold more than 11 million Walmart shares year-to-date in 2026. — A sustained pattern of selling throughout the year suggests a systemic reduction in position by the company's primary insiders.
-0.30Wall Street analysts maintain a 'strong buy' rating for WMT with a 12-month average price target of $142.46. — Positive analyst sentiment provides a fundamental floor and counter-narrative to the insider selling, though it carries less immediate weight than the actual trades.
